Build and own core platform features managing a large multi-vendor GPU fleet for AI training and inference, including scheduling, scaling, multi-tenancy, RBAC, and observability.
Develop control-plane services, autoscaling controllers, inference-serving platforms, and APIs/CLI for ML teams enabling thousands of GPUs usage without human intervention per job.
Design, implement, and ship end-to-end infrastructure capabilities with a product mindset focusing on usability, performance, and self-service for internal ML users.
5+ years experience building infrastructure or platform software with a record of designing and shipping substantial systems or control planes.
Proficiency in Go or Python for building maintainable, production-debuggable systems.
Deep understanding of Kubernetes controller and internals including scheduler, operators, and API mechanisms.
Working knowledge of GPU-specific platform constraints such as MIG, GPU sharing, gang scheduling, topology-aware placement, and multi-tenant hardware resource contention.
Experienced systems engineer with hands-on expertise in Kubernetes operator/controller development at a deep level and GPU platform scheduling.
Strong product mindset focusing on internal developer experience and platform adoption rather than only operational metrics.
Capability to own infrastructure features end-to-end from design through rollout, documentation, and enablement of self-service for AI workloads.
